"When the house was out of sight, I sat, with my bird-cage in the  
straw at my feet, forward on the low seat to look out of the high  
window, watching the frosty trees, that were like beautiful pieces of  
spar, and the fields all smooth and white with last night's snow, and  
the sun, so red but yielding so little heat, and the ice, dark like  
metal where the skaters and sliders had brushed the snow away."

         --Charles Dickens (_Bleak House_, Ch. 3)
